Thread: Nice settings for Photomatix | Forum: Photography
TBH one very good way to go is:
Strenght: 100, smoothing max, saturation at middle. Max luminosity, max micro. Leave others at 0.
Then, create another exposure fusion pic. Import all exposures to photoshop as layers, then exposure fusion and then HDR.
Then mask or erase parts that dont look ok. Skies often come horrible with HDR and loads of noise when exposure fusion skies look damn lot better. Ghosts aka moving people etc can be masked from 0 EV shot etc.
